
A CONCRETE KICKSTARTER PROJECT
This campaign funds one clear deliverable: a redesigned, low-friction prototype frame that fully unlocks ClimbStation’s new weight-regulated engine controller.
01
BUILD THE FRAME
Manufacture the lower-friction mechanical frame designed around the new controller.
02
TEST THE SYSTEM
Validate the controller’s smooth, self-regulating performance with the redesigned mechanics.
03
PREPARE DELIVERY
Use the verified prototype to prepare safe, reliable production for interested customers and early supporters.

BUILT ON REAL-WORLD USE
ClimbStation has been moving people since 2009. Backing this next frame helps bring a simpler, safer rotating wall, and its new weight-regulated engine controller, to production.
SINCE 2009
Portable, motorized climbing walls shipped to sports centers, schools, gyms, corporate spaces and events worldwide.
20+ COUNTRIES
From Helsinki and Espoo to San Diego, Shanghai, Abu Dhabi and beyond, serving public, commercial and education partners.
THE NEXT FRAME
Funding unlocks a redesigned low-friction frame so the new controller can deliver its full safety, reliability and cost advantage.
Commercial target: product pricing from USD 7,500–15,000, plus rental,
revenue-sharing and Climbing-as-a-Service options for events and operators.
